LuxairCARGO Manager Special Services Cargo, Patrick Silverio highlighted the benefits, “In 2017, the Cargo Center of the airport operated by LuxairCARGO registered about 200.000 CMR. Document treatment, signing, stamping and archiving are definitively a time-consuming factor, which with the e-CMR will be highly reduced”.

Founded in 2017, and having secured a deal with Waitrose by early 2018, KINN soon afterwards chose to use The NX Group for all of its retail distribution. The two companies then agreed upon a recycled packaging option in line with KINN’s brand ethos of “clean beauty” for its customers, their homes and the environment.
Penske Logistics was recently named “2017 Carrier of the Year” by MI Windows and Doors, LLC, one of the nation’s largest suppliers of vinyl and aluminum windows and doors. Penske was recognized with the supplier award due to its excellence in interplant communications, driver retention, cost control, and customer satisfaction.
